Prolactin heterogeneity in the serum and milk during lactation
Authors:Richard R Gala  Cynthia Van De Walle
Institution:Department of Physiology, Wayne State University School of Medicine, Detroit, Michigan 48201, USA
Abstract:Prolactin heterogeneity in serum and milk were separated using Sephadex G-100. Three components were present in serum from lactating women with the following proportions: “void volume” -13.4%, “big” - 26.4%, and “little” - 60.3%. Milk from the same subjects did not contain “big” prolactin. Over 90% of the prolactin found in milk was “little” prolactin. The “little” prolactin in milk may not be similar to the “little” prolactin in the serum.
